IRON REAGAN To Release “The Tyranny Of Will”

Monday, 30th June 2014

IRON REAGAN’s Relapse debut, The Tyranny Of Will, is a 24 song wrecking ball of hardcore-punk/thrash fury. The album was recorded with guitarist Phil Hall at Blaze of Torment Studios in Richmond, VA and self-produced plus it was mixed by Converge’s Kurt Ballou. Today the band has confirmed a September 16th release date for North America, (September 15th – UK/World), September 12th (Germany/Benelux/World). The album artwork and tracklisting have been revealed today as well. The cover art was done Alexis Maybree AKA NevaSafe.

Fronted by the venomously lyrical Tony Foresta (Municipal Waste), on paper IRON REAGAN is a Richmond, Virginia super group (the band also features Phil Hall of Municipal Waste, Cannabis Corpse, etc. as well as Ryan Parrish formerly of Darkest Hour together with members of Mammoth Grinder).

Tony Foresta commented on the new album: “This might be my favorite thing I’ve ever worked on. It’s definitely the heaviest sounding. I’m really excited to get this record out to people. Everyone worked their asses off on this one and I think it shows”.

Drummer Ryan Parrish added: “This record looks exactly how it sounds. Savage. Everyone involved with Tyranny Of Will, from the artwork to the recording, mixing, and mastering process, went above and beyond and hopefully all of you maniacs out there will crank it to 11!”

In practice, IRON REAGAN are WAY more than just a super group project. They have toured the world several times over leveling audiences with their furious live show. The band has lined up tour dates for July supporting EyeHateGod. These dates begin July 10th in Washington, DC and run through July 15th in Brooklyn, NY. The band has a huge hometown show scheduled for July 23rd and will be taking part in this year’s GWAR-B-Q and Fun Fun Fun Fest.
